Abstract

Objective: This study aimed at studying Ismail Lutfi Japakiya’s goals of education, educational provision and concept of Mu‘allim  Rabbani (Teacher of the Sustainer).

Methodology: The study was qualitative research. Data gained from the documentary study that was focused on the primary documents written by Ismail Lutfi Japakiya himself particularly his works which were relevant to the concept of education, educational model and characteristics of teachers. Main books of focus were Mu‘allim Rabbani, Revelation, Ummat Wahidah (one nation) and Let Be Brothers. Data was analyzed via content analysis and its presentation through descriptive manner.

Research Findings: Lutfi Japakiya’s goals of education aim at knowing Allah, believing in Allah to gain goodness, stable dignity both in this world and hereafter not for gaining worldly benefit. Educational provision should be provided in three forms, namely: listening, understanding and practicing. Besides these, measurement and evaluation need to be practiced contentiously. Regarding Mu‘allim  Rabbani, it has the following characteristics:  1) Faham. It means understanding, possessing knowledge and understanding in many fields including knowledge on the Quran, Sunnah and specific areas of knowledge. 2) Characteristics of being the Nabi, namely, Sidq, Tabligh, Fatonah and Amanah. 3) Possessing good Akhlaq, for example, patience, kindness, love, care, responsibility and respecting others. All these characters needed to be possessed by all teachers.

Application: Applying Mu‘allim  Rabbani characteristics to be possessed by teachers in every educational institution.
